The Derrell C. Roberts Library provides access to an extensive collection
of resources and services. This recently expanded and renovated 57,700
square foot facility houses approximately 135,597 volumes, over 200 current periodical subscriptions,
10,000+ media items, 59,609+ e-books, and is a selective federal government
documents repository. Books, periodicals, government documents, e-books, and
media can be identified by using the GIL-Find Online Catalog . Dalton State
affiliated patrons can use the GIL Universal Catalog to locate materials
owned by other USG libraries to facilitate interlibrary loan or GIL Express
borrowing. Through the GALILEO (Georgia Library Learning Online) virtual
library, 88 workstations offer access to 200+ full-text databases with over
64,000 full-text periodicals, subject indexes and directories, online
reference materials, and Georgia documents and historical papers. GALILEO,
Georgia’s statewide library consortia, is essential in providing library
users with online resources through cooperative licensing. Library users may access these resources on campus without a password. All students and faculty, including distance learners, can gain off-campus access by going to the library’s main page and clicking on Off Campus access
and entering their myDaltonState username and password.

Other resources include small collections of popular titles and children’s award winning literature, small group study rooms which are primarily reserved for groups of two or more students, and a break room which is outfitted with vending machines.
Distance learning and off-campus students can get assistance from our Ask-A-Librarian
link service, or from one of our community partner libraries in Pickens, and Gilmer counties. You can physically visit the library
